Output 0593e7597a9330c17e8eb39b4d37c61e478e92cb14bfe1f2d8d6b0a139deacf6:760

value
43269
script pubkey
OP_0 OP_PUSHBYTES_20 773f45d853ea034399da78eef0213d36bc7307b7
address
bc1qwul5tkznagp58xw60rh0qgfax678xpahty3l56
transaction
0593e7597a9330c17e8eb39b4d37c61e478e92cb14bfe1f2d8d6b0a139deacf6
confirmations
251149
spent
true